Exclaim! reports that Devo bassist Gerald Casale is quite offended with one of the new McDonald’s American Idol toys. “New Wave Nigel,” as the figurine is called, sports a red flowerpot hat not unlike - well, exactly like - the “Energy Domes” designed by Casale for the band.

Ironically, Devo has always satirized and poked fun at consumerist culture and popular trends. They have taken the corporate giant to court over copyright infringement, and there is no word on whether New Wave Nigel will be pulled from the shelves.
Other dolls in the Idol series include Disco Dave and Country Clay.
